您是否在寻找关于软件工程宿舍管理系统ER图的设计方法?本文将带您深入了解宿舍管理系统中ER图的作用、设计步骤及其实现方式。从实体关系的确定到实际数据库建模,助您掌握核心技巧!
比如我们学校要开发一个宿舍管理系统,需要先画ER图,那具体应该怎么设计呢?
设计软件工程宿舍管理系统的ER图是一个重要的前期工作。以下是具体步骤:
如果您想更深入地了解宿舍管理系统的开发,可以点击免费注册试用我们的系统模板,或预约演示,获取专业指导。

假如宿舍管理系统中,不仅有学生和宿舍的关系,还有宿舍和维修工的关系,该怎么在ER图里表示呢?
在软件工程宿舍管理系统ER图中处理复杂关系时,可以采用以下方法:
1. 分析关系类型:
我听说很多人在设计宿舍管理系统ER图时会犯一些低级错误,这些错误都有哪些呢?
在设计软件工程宿舍管理系统ER图时,确实有一些常见错误需要注意:
1. 实体定义不清晰:比如把“学生姓名”作为实体,而不是属性。正确做法是将“学生”定义为实体,“姓名”作为其属性。
2. 关系定义错误:例如把“学生”和“宿舍”的关系定义为一对一,实际上应该是多对一。
3. 属性遗漏或冗余:忘记添加必要的属性(如宿舍容量),或者重复定义属性(如同时记录“宿舍号”和“楼栋号”)。
4. 忽视数据完整性:未考虑约束条件,如学号必须唯一。
为了避免这些问题,建议使用成熟的工具辅助设计,并定期检查模型。如果需要更专业的帮助,可以点击免费注册试用,或预约演示。
如果我们以后想给宿舍管理系统增加功能,比如统计电费,ER图是不是也需要提前设计好呢?
是的,在设计软件工程宿舍管理系统ER图时,必须考虑扩展性。以下是一些建议:
1. 模块化设计:将系统功能划分为独立模块,例如“入住管理”、“维修管理”、“费用管理”等,方便后续扩展。
2. 预留接口:在ER图中为可能的功能预留空间,如增加“电费”实体及其与“宿舍”的关系。
3. 使用通用模型:选择灵活的数据库模型(如关系型数据库),支持未来功能的无缝接入。
通过象限分析,我们可以看到扩展性是系统长期成功的关键因素之一。如果您希望了解更多扩展方案,欢迎点击免费注册试用或预约演示。
宿舍管理系统最终是要给学生和管理员用的,那ER图能不能体现用户体验呢?
虽然ER图主要是描述数据结构,但也可以间接体现用户体验:
1. 简化操作流程:通过优化实体和关系设计,减少用户操作步骤。例如,将“查询空床位”功能直接与“宿舍”实体关联。
2. 提供个性化信息:在ER图中设计用户偏好相关实体,如“通知设置”,允许用户选择接收消息的方式。
3. 考虑多角色需求:确保ER图涵盖所有用户角色(如学生、管理员、维修工),并为其提供专属功能。
通过SWOT分析,我们可以发现良好的ER图设计能够显著提升用户体验。如果您想体验更人性化的宿舍管理系统,可以点击免费注册试用或预约演示。
免责申明:本文内容通过 AI 工具匹配关键字智能整合而成,仅供参考,伙伴云不对内容的真实、准确、完整作任何形式的承诺。如有任何问题或意见,您可以通过联系 12345@huoban.com 进行反馈,伙伴云收到您的反馈后将及时处理并反馈。



































